Introduction to Area Code 520

Area code 520 was introduced in 1995 as a split from area code 602, which was one of the original area codes established in 1947. The creation of 520 was necessary due to the rapid growth of the region it serves, primarily in southern Arizona. This growth led to an increase in phone number demand, which could no longer be met by the existing area code. Since its implementation, area code 520 has become an integral part of the telecommunications infrastructure in Arizona, particularly in the Tucson metropolitan area and surrounding regions.

Geographical Coverage of Area Code 520

Area code 520 primarily serves the southern part of Arizona, with its coverage including but not limited to the city of Tucson and its metropolitan area. The region’s diverse geography ranges from desert landscapes to mountainous territories, showcasing the natural beauty and ecological diversity of Arizona. The area code’s boundaries stretch across several counties, including Pima, Pinal, Santa Cruz, Cochise, Graham, Greenlee, and parts of Yuma and La Paz counties. This extensive coverage underscores the significant role area code 520 plays in connecting communities across southern Arizona.

What is Area Code 520 and where is it located?

Area Code 520 is a telephone area code in the North American Numbering Plan that covers the state of Arizona, specifically the southern and central regions. It was created in 1995 as a split from the original area code 602, which covered the entire state. The 520 area code serves a large geographic area, including the cities of Tucson, Sierra Vista, and Nogales, as well as several smaller towns and communities.

The 520 area code is bounded by the 928 area code to the north and the 480 and 602 area codes to the northwest. It covers a diverse range of geography, from the desert landscapes of southern Arizona to the mountainous regions of southeastern Arizona. The area code is also home to several major military installations, including Davis-Monthan Air Force Base and Fort Huachuca, which contribute to the local economy and population. What are the major cities and zip codes served by Area Code 520?

The 520 area code serves several major cities and towns in southern and central Arizona, including Tucson, Sierra Vista, Nogales, Green Valley, and Oro Valley. Some of the major zip codes served by the 520 area code include 85701-85775 (Tucson), 85635 (Sierra Vista), 85621 (Nogales), 85614 (Green Valley), and 85737-85755 (Oro Valley). These cities and zip codes are home to a diverse range of industries, including technology, healthcare, education, and tourism, which contribute to the local economy and population growth.

In addition to these major cities and zip codes, the 520 area code also serves several smaller towns and communities, including Casas Adobes, Catalina Foothills, Marana, and Sahuarita. These areas are known for their natural beauty, outdoor recreational opportunities, and growing populations. The 520 area code is also home to several major highways, including Interstate 10 and Interstate 19, which provide convenient access to nearby cities and attractions. How does Area Code 520 relate to Arizona’s geography and climate?

Area Code 520 is closely tied to the geography and climate of southern and central Arizona. The region is characterized by a diverse range of landscapes, including deserts, mountains, and valleys. The Sonoran Desert, which covers much of the area, is known for its hot and dry climate, with very little rainfall throughout the year. The mountains, including the Santa Catalina and Rincon ranges, provide a cooler and more temperate climate, with greater precipitation and vegetation. The 520 area code also includes several major rivers, including the Santa Cruz and San Pedro, which provide water and support a wide range of wildlife.

The geography and climate of the 520 area code have a significant impact on the local population and economy. The warm and sunny climate makes the area a popular destination for tourists and snowbirds, who come to escape colder winters and enjoy outdoor recreational activities such as hiking, biking, and golfing. The desert landscapes and mountainous regions also provide a unique and challenging environment for industries such as agriculture, mining, and construction. What are some popular attractions and activities in Area Code 520?

The 520 area code is home to a wide range of popular attractions and activities, including outdoor recreational opportunities, cultural events, and historical landmarks. Some of the most popular attractions include Saguaro National Park, Sabino Canyon Recreation Area, and the Arizona-Sonora Desert Museum, which showcase the natural beauty and unique wildlife of the Sonoran Desert. The area is also known for its rich cultural heritage, with several Native American reservations, including the Tohono O’odham Nation and the Pascua Yaqui Tribe, which offer a glimpse into the history and traditions of the region.

In addition to these natural and cultural attractions, the 520 area code is also home to several major events and festivals, including the Tucson Gem and Mineral Show, the Tucson Festival of Books, and the Fourth Avenue Spring Street Fair. These events draw visitors from across the country and provide a showcase for local artists, musicians, and artisans. The area is also known for its vibrant downtown areas, including downtown Tucson and downtown Sierra Vista, which offer a range of shopping, dining, and entertainment options.
